Output ed80e5443ad7ae4f6c18d258d06396337b32b44eb3343961dff186ee738d5403:1

value
366000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a926c58f67ed9a6e9cbe4a25fc3c6a4dc1b8761 OP_EQUAL
address
3EKiagSoNUVHmk9sE8cv1CJaRPhgjpw5gM
transaction
ed80e5443ad7ae4f6c18d258d06396337b32b44eb3343961dff186ee738d5403
spent
true